What Does Laboring Down Mean

what does laboring down mean

Laboring down refers to the period of time during labor when a woman’s body naturally starts to push the baby down. However, instead of actively pushing, the woman lets her body do the work while she conserves her energy for the final stage of pushing. It’s a common practice in midwifery and can help reduce the risk of tearing and exhaustion for the birthing mother.
